Building Materials and Their Effect on Wi-Fi Signals
Material
Wi-Fi Attenuation
Wood, Drywall, Particle Board, Tile
Low
Glass
Low
Water
Medium
Bricks, Cinder Block
Medium
Plaster, Stucco
High
Concrete
High
Tinted or Low-E Glass (metalized)
Very High
Metal
Very High
lower the attenuation, the better the performance.
Installation Variables
Before installing the GigaSpire BLAST u4 or Mesh BLAST u4m, consider what additional
services may be implemented. Various access points are available on the back of the unit
which may or may not be used. Prior to determining the unit's final location, you need to
account for the following variables:
Optional: Where will the Ethernet cable be routed?
What type of building material is used in this facility? Make sure you have the appropriate
drills, drill bits and fasteners for routing Ethernet or power cables as they pass through
walls and the like.
